Yamaha Fascino 125
The Yamaha Fascino 125 has a top speed of ~95 km/h (estimated real-world; note: manufacturer does not officially publish top speed), produces 8.2 hp and weighs 99 kg. Motoryk rates it 7.5/10.
Yamaha Fascino pertama kali diperkenalkan di India pada tahun 2015 sebagai skuter 113cc bergaya yang menargetkan komuter perkotaan, terutama pengendara wanita, dengan desain yang terinspirasi retro. Pada tahun 2021, Yamaha meningkatkan jajaran produk dengan Fascino 125 Fi Hybrid, yang menampilkan mesin injeksi bahan bakar 125cc dan sistem hibrida ringan Smart Motor Generator (SMG) — yang pertama untuk segmen ini di India. Ini tetap populer karena perpaduan efisiensi bahan bakar, teknologi modern, dan estetika modis di pasar skuter India yang kompetitif.

Apa yang Harus Diketahui Pembeli
Blue Core Engine Efficiency
The Fascino 125 uses Yamaha's Blue Core 125cc fuel-injected engine, delivering around 55-60 kmpl real-world mileage. This technology also reduces friction internally, contributing to longer engine life with proper maintenance.
Watch the Belt Drive
The CVT belt is a known wear item — owners report needing replacement around 30,000–40,000 km if not maintained properly. Always check belt condition during pre-purchase inspection to avoid a costly early replacement.
Strong Resale Retention
Yamaha scooters hold resale value better than most competitors in the 125cc segment due to the brand's reliability reputation. A well-maintained Fascino 125 typically retains 60–70% of its value after 3 years.

Ulasan Pembeli Bekas
"The sensible scooter choice that almost never disappoints its owner."
$800-$1,800 usedThe Fascino 125 is Yamaha doing what Yamaha does best — building something reliable enough to embarrass bikes twice its price. The Blue Core engine is genuinely impressive for a 125cc scooter; it sips fuel and rarely complains. On used examples, check the CVT belt around 20,000km because owners often skip it, and listen for any rattling from the underseat storage area — cheap plastic clips crack early. The chassis handles city traffic with surprising confidence, and the braking is decent for the class. That said, don't expect excitement. This is a commuter, not a canyon carver, and the suspension gets sloppy on rougher surfaces with a pillion aboard. Parts availability is good in most Asian markets but can be patchy elsewhere. Resale value stays strong, which means sellers know what they have — don't expect a steal. Check service history obsessively; neglected oil changes on these engines show up fast as top-end wear.

What are common problems with the Yamaha Fascino 125? +
Fuel injector clogging causing rough idle: Start cold, listen for rough idle or hesitation (moderate) | Front suspension fork oil leaks: Inspect fork seals for oil residue or staining (moderate) | Battery draining quickly on older units: Test cold start, check if lights dim during idle (minor)

What is the horsepower of the Yamaha Fascino 125? +
The Yamaha Fascino 125 produces 8.2 hp @ 6,500 rpm, with 10.3 Nm @ 5,000 rpm of torque. Top speed: ~95 km/h (estimated real-world; note: manufacturer does not officially publish top speed).
